Montana State University, School of Art

Bozeman, MT US

About: The School of Art at Montana State University-Bozeman offers a challenging curriculum and state-of-the-art facilities for intensive graduate and undergraduate studies. Our 17 full-time faculty are active professionals who are engaged in their respective disciplines. They are committed to creating a rigorous and vital intellectual environment and to providing personal guidance to prepare students for a successful career in the arts. Our program allows for intense one-on-one instruction and encourages interdisciplinary exploration. The recently completed 6,000 sq. ft. graduate studio building provides spacious light-filled studios with mountain views and a gallery for exhibitions. The School supports an outstanding lecture series that has enabled our students to interact with some of the best artists and critics in the country. The Montana State University campus is surrounded by four Rocky Mountain ranges that provide excellent skiing, hiking, climbing and mountain biking minutes from campus. The nearby rivers offer picturesque vistas and world-class fly fishing, kayaking, and rafting.
